Wolf Whistle gives De Kock his Second Rashidiya

Mike de Kock trained his second successive winner of the US$200,000 Al Rashidiya (Gr.III) when Wolf Whistle dug deep to claim the 1,777 metres turf race at Nad Al Sheba, on Thursday`s seventh meeting of the 2005 Dubai International Racing Carnival.

Partnered by Weichong Marwing, who had already ridden two winners earlier in the evening, Wolf Whistle was towards the rear with the Richard Mullen-partnered Dutch Gold setting the pace over the Dubai Duty Free (Gr.I) course and distance.

Coming into the straight Wolf Whistle, a Carnival winner on January 27th, was three wide and began to make progress to lead at the 200 metre post. Shakis, ridden by Richard Hills and trained by Doug Watson, went with Wolf Whistle on the rail and the pair fought it out to the line.

As the pair flashed past the post, Wolf Whistle got up by a short head from Shakis in a photo-finish. Membership, Richard Hughes in the saddle, came with a late run on the outside to finish four and a three quarters lengths back in third with Robbie Osborne`s Latino Magic in fourth.

De Kock, who trained Right Approach to win the 2004 Al Rashidiya (Gr.I) and Dubai Duty Free (Gr.I) in a dead-heat said, "That was a great performance from Wolf Whistle, he loves to get into a scrap and he generally puts his head down in the right place. That race did not go according to plan, he was sluggish and we got squeezed and had to go three deep. For him to win it was impressive. The Dubai Duty Free is the plan, we are waiting for our invite but after tonight I am sure we will get it."

Parole Board, trained by Mazin Al Kurdi and ridden by Ted Durcan, was the easiest of winners in the US$25,000 San Isidro Maiden over 1,400 metres on the dirt.

Parole Board, who was a runner-up to UAE 2000 Guineas winner Stagelight in a conditions race on his career debut, has definitely come on for the run and was always going well throughout the race.

Durcan allowed the son of Dynaformer to take the lead at the 400 metres pole and was soon clear. The three-year-old was eased near the finish to win by four and a half lengths from stablemate British Isles and the Godolphin runner Saalb.

Bo Bid gave Al Kurdi a quick double when battling on hard to the line to win the US$110,000 Nakayama International Stakes over 1,600 metres on the dirt from the Dhruba Selvaratnam-trained Marbush.

De Kock`s Kill Cat, the mount of Weichong Marwing, set the early pace with Marbush, under Pat Smullen, coming to take the lead 400 metres out. Bob Bid, who finished third over this course and distance a week ago, was always travelling well and soon challenged the leader and the pair were locked in a head to head battle with Bo Bid getting up on the line to win by half a length.

Damachida, trained in Norway by Eva Sundbye, came from last in the straight to win the US$120,000 Sandown Park International Stakes over 1,300 metres on the turf.

Ridden by Marwing, Damachida, was settled in towards the rear with the pace being set by the Turkish challenger Kaneko. Millennium Force, trained by Mick Channon, and Jeremy Noseda`s Twilight Blues were running on well in the closing stages but Damachida was in control 100 metres out and ran on to a half length win.

Macau challenger Change The Grange, trained by M C Tam, made all to give Marwing his second win of the evening when claiming the US$90,000 Maisons-Laffitte International Stakes over 1,700 metres.

Coming into the straight Change The Grange always looked the winner and ran on to a two and three quarter length victory from Dubai Vision and Gold History.

Dhruba Selvaratnam`s Seihali claimed his second Carnival victory when he landed the US$120,000 Chester International Stakes over 1,600 metres on the turf. Seihali, a course and distance winner two weeks ago, raced in mid-division with Godolphin`s Three Graces setting the pace under Frankie Dettori.

Smullen go to work on Seihali and took the lead 300 metres out before stepping up a gear to win by three quarters of a length from the fast finishing Trademark with James Bethell`s Mine in third.

Afghan followed up from his course and distance win a week ago when landing the US$110,000 Hoppegarten International Stakes over 2,000 metres on the dirt.

Afghan, who was winning his third Carnival race, dug deep under Durcan to fend off the challenges of Alma`arry and Deodatus to win by a length.

Swedish Shave, ridden by Thierry Jarnet, got up in the shadow of the line to win the final race of the evening, the US$120,000 Naas International Stakes over 1,300 metres on the turf for trainer Richard Gibson. Compton`s Eleven, trained by Mick Channon, led close home but had to settle for second with Jonny Ebeneezer coming with a late run to finish third.
